Output e21d8ef16b2260a6cd090ab523e0dd9f0e664a2437f3c134db2880b89aacaa4f:0

value
273033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ebaf9f141aa56637f38488b530187d6aa0f3ec8 OP_EQUAL
address
3BnWEzJXXUpCk5EpcWK6BEqxk8vraa6aWp
transaction
e21d8ef16b2260a6cd090ab523e0dd9f0e664a2437f3c134db2880b89aacaa4f
spent
true